Frequently Asked Questions

You may notice improved mood, reduced stress, better sleep, and increased energy when ashwagandha is working effectively for you. Individual responses can vary.

Ashwagandha may help improve skin health indirectly by reducing stress, which can contribute to skin issues. However, its effects on skin can vary among individuals.

Ashwagandha is commonly used for stress management, but it may also offer various other potential health benefits, such as improved sleep and mood.

Ashwagandha may have a calming effect, which can contribute to better sleep, but it doesn't necessarily make everyone sleepy during the day. Individual responses may vary.

Whether ashwagandha is worth taking depends on individual goals and needs. Many people find it beneficial for stress reduction and overall well-being, but results can vary.

Pregnant and breastfeeding women, people with certain medical conditions, and those taking specific medications should consult a healthcare professional before taking ashwagandha.

Ashwagandha is considered a dietary supplement and is not specifically FDA approved. However, reputable manufacturers adhere to FDA guidelines for safety and quality.

While ashwagandha is generally safe for long-term use, it's advisable to consult with a healthcare professional if you plan to take it regularly over an extended period.

Ashwagandha is not a steroid. It is an adaptogenic herb used for its potential stress-reducing and health-promoting properties.

Ashwagandha is not typically associated with hair loss and may even indirectly support hair health by reducing stress.
